Best Practices

  • Connection Timeout: Set a reasonable connection timeout to prevent indefinite waiting.
  • Pool Size: Adjust the pool size based on the application's workload and database server capacity.
  • Connection Testing: Implement connection validation to ensure connections are still valid before use.
